Requirements of an albergo diffuso

Each Italian region will have its own different regulations and requirements for new “diffuso” hotels. These are the requirements of a scattered hotel according to the model developed by Giancarlo Dall’Ara:

  • Single management – Accommodation facility managed in an entrepreneurial form in the centre.
  • Hotel services – Hotel accommodation facility managed professionally.
  • Residential units located in several separate and pre-existing buildings in an inhabited historic centre.
  • Common services – Presence of rooms used as common areas for guests, such as a reception, bar, or refreshment point.
  • Reasonable distance of the buildings – maximum 200 metres between the housing units and the structure with the reception services.
  • A living community – In other words not a complete ghost town. On the other hand you don’t want to discover that the village rock band practice next door every night either.
  • An authentic environment – Integration with the social reality and local culture. A good relationship will need to be built with the locals, to make sure they are all on board and recognise the benefits to the village, of being welcoming to guests.
  • Recognisability – Defined and uniform identity of the structure; homogeneity of the services offered
  • Management style integrated into the territory and its culture
